Epoxy and acrylic are both types of resins used in coatings and adhesives. The main difference is that epoxy is a stronger and more durable material, while acrylic is more flexible and resistant to UV light. This difference impacts their uses in various applications - epoxy is often used for heavy-duty applications like flooring and industrial coatings, while acrylic is more commonly used in decorative coatings and art projects.
